Abstract

Disclosed is a system and method for the monitoring and authorization of an optimization device in a network. In exemplary embodiments, an optimization device transmits an authorization request message to a portal to receive authorization to operate. The portal transmits an authorization response message to the optimization device with capability parameters for operation of the device, including at least one expiration parameter for the authorization. The optimization device sends updated authorization request messages to the portal with its device usage information, such that the portal can dynamically monitor the optimization device and continue to authorize its operation.

Claims (41)

1. A system for monitoring and authorizing operation of an optimization device in a network, comprising:

an optimization device comprising:

an interface module that facilitates communication between the optimization device and the network;

an optimization module that facilitates data transfer across the network using at least one optimization technique; and

a storage module in communication with the optimization module, the storage module including memory to store at least one copy of selected data for use in the at least one optimization technique, the selected data for use in the at least one optimization technique comprising a subset of data facilitated for transfer across the network by the optimization module; and

at least one portal in communication with the interface module of the optimization device, wherein the portal:

receives an authorization request message from the optimization device, the authorization request message comprising a customer identifier and customer location where the optimization device is deployed;

determines, based at least in part on the customer identifier, that the optimization device is authorized for operation;

determines capability parameters for the optimization device, the capability parameters including a plurality of expiry parameter thresholds at which the optimization device is to report device usage information to the portal, the device usage information including an amount of data transferred; and

transmits an authorization response message to the optimization device, the authorization response message comprising the determined capability parameters, wherein the authorization response message further comprises configuration information to configure a firewall at the optimization device to access a remote software service provider.

2. The system of claim 1 , wherein the capability parameters for the optimization device comprise at least one of a cumulative data processing capacity for modules of the optimization device, and a data rate limit for the optimization device.

3. The system of claim 1 , wherein the capability parameters for the optimization device comprise an expiry parameter, a warning parameter, and a refresh parameter.
